
Mazda2 sedan confirmed to arrive in 2015
THE Mazda2 sedan will arrive in Australia later this year.
It will be the first time we've had a sedan version of the '2 since 2010. Prices have not been revealed.
Like its hatchback sibling, Mazda2 sedan will be available with two transmission types, the six-speed automatic and six-speed manual, and with two 1.5-litre petrol engine choices.
The standard SKYACTIV-G petrol engine delivers 79kW of power and 139Nm of torque, while the more powerful high-spec alternative puts out 81kW of power at 6000rpm and maximum torque of 141Nm at 4000rpm.
It offers fuel economy figures from as little as 4.9 litres/100km and Smart City Brake Support will be available as an option across the range.
